NAME
     gluUnProject4 - map window and clip coordinates to object coordinates

C SPECIFICATION
     GLint gluUnProject4( GLdouble winX,
			  GLdouble winY,
			  GLdouble winZ,
			  GLdouble clipW,
			  const GLdouble *model,
			  const GLdouble *proj,
			  const GLint *view,
			  GLdouble near,
			  GLdouble far,
			  GLdouble* objX,
			  GLdouble* objY,
			  GLdouble* objZ,
			  GLdouble* objW )

PARAMETERS
     winX, winY, winZ
		     Specify the window coordinates to be mapped.

     clipW	     Specify the clip w coordinate to be mapped.

     model	     Specifies the modelview matrix (as from a glGetDoublev
		     call).

     proj	     Specifies the projection matrix (as from a glGetDoublev
		     call).

     view	     Specifies the viewport (as from a glGetIntegerv call).

     near, far	     Specifies the near and far planes (as from a glGetDoublev
		     call).

     objX, objY, objZ, objW
		     Returns the computed object coordinates.

DESCRIPTION
     gluUnProject4 maps the specified window coordinates winX, winY and winZ
     and its clip w coordinate clipW into object coordinates (objX, objY,
     objZ, objW) using model, proj and view. clipW can be other than 1 as for
     vertices in glFeedbackBuffer when data type GL_4D_COLOR_TEXTURE is
     returned.	This also handles the case where the near and far planes are
     different from the default, 0 and 1, respectively.	 A return value of
     GL_TRUE indicates success; a return value of GL_FALSE indicates failure.

     To compute the coordinates (objX, objY, objZ and objW), gluUnProject4
     multiplies the normalized device coordinates by the inverse of model*proj
     as follows:

     INV() denotes matrix inversion.

     gluUnProject4 is equivalent to gluUnProject when clipW is 1, near is 0
     and far is 1.

NOTES
     gluUnProject4 is available only if the GLU version is 1.3 or greater.
